He was a retired farmer and was a World War I veteran.
Surviving are his wife, Alma Hampton; a son, Merle Hampton of Marmaduke; two grandchildren, Devon Hampton of Marmaduke and Neilous Ray Hampton of Paragould, and six great-grandchildren.
The funeral was at Mitchell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Wayne Gould presiding.
Interment was in Ramer's Chapel Cemetery with Mitchell Funeral Home in charge of services.
